by Joyce Carol Oates

Joyce Carol Oates is in full fire here. The motifs and themes of this rich, intricately textured, realistic novel belong to the American experience of the 1950s and '60s. But the vision of life that animates them is so clear and unflinching that the past comes to us with the force of revelation.
